  • Breccia Texture: Understanding Angular Rock Fragments
    Breccia has a clastic texture. This means it's made up of angular fragments of rock cemented together.

    Here's why:

    * Angular Fragments: Unlike other sedimentary rocks like conglomerate, which have rounded fragments, breccia's fragments are sharp and jagged. This indicates the source material didn't travel far before being cemented.

    * Cemented Together: The angular fragments are held together by a matrix of finer-grained material, such as clay or calcite.

    The texture of breccia is a key feature that distinguishes it from other sedimentary rocks.
